Output 270c59eaae6aebae72f400c5743a662829ad802f316d723a180ab40158fbfb7a:0

value
2331737
script pubkey
OP_0 OP_PUSHBYTES_20 1b96962f8eeb170526eada78bec53426526a9e35
address
bc1qrwtfvtuwavts2fh2mfuta3f5yefx4834dwfczh
transaction
270c59eaae6aebae72f400c5743a662829ad802f316d723a180ab40158fbfb7a
spent
true